Output 04170339cfeccb527705a450df993a93dc83ca5d52df09efdffa4e939fd63ab6:0

value
201211
script pubkey
OP_0 OP_PUSHBYTES_20 80f311aaac8b5b30e592c437fd68c6293da67b93
address
bc1qsre3r24v3ddnpevjcsml66xx9y76v7unxchh29
transaction
04170339cfeccb527705a450df993a93dc83ca5d52df09efdffa4e939fd63ab6
confirmations
27088
spent
true